TurboFiles

SWF to F4V Converter

TurboFiles offers an online SWF to F4V Converter.
Just drop files, we'll handle the rest

SWF

SWF (Shockwave Flash) is a multimedia file format developed by Macromedia (now Adobe) for vector graphics, animation, and interactive web content. Originally designed for rich web experiences, SWF files contain compressed vector and raster graphics, ActionScript code, and audio/video elements that can be rendered by Flash Player. Despite declining popularity, it was once a dominant format for web animations and interactive web applications.

Advantages

Compact file size, supports vector and raster graphics, enables complex animations, cross-platform compatibility, embedded ActionScript for interactivity, supports streaming media, and allows sophisticated visual effects with relatively small file sizes.

Disadvantages

Security vulnerabilities, browser support declining, performance overhead, proprietary format, requires Flash Player plugin, not mobile-friendly, limited accessibility, and gradually being replaced by HTML5, CSS3, and JavaScript technologies.

Use cases

Historically used for web animations, interactive websites, online games, educational content, banner advertisements, and multimedia presentations. Widely adopted in early web design for creating dynamic, engaging user interfaces. Commonly used in browser-based games, interactive e-learning modules, and rich media advertising before HTML5 and modern web technologies emerged.

F4V

F4V is an Adobe video file format based on the ISO base media file format (MPEG-4 Part 12), primarily used for delivering high-quality video content over the internet. Developed as an evolution of the FLV format, F4V supports advanced video compression techniques, including H.264 video and AAC audio encoding, enabling efficient streaming and playback of multimedia content.

Advantages

Supports high-quality video compression, efficient streaming capabilities, compatible with modern web technologies, enables adaptive bitrate streaming, and provides excellent audio-video synchronization. Offers better compression than older FLV formats.

Disadvantages

Limited native support in some media players, potential compatibility issues with older systems, requires specific codecs for playback, and gradually becoming less relevant with the decline of Flash technology.

Use cases

F4V is commonly used in web-based video platforms, online streaming services, multimedia presentations, and digital video distribution. It's particularly prevalent in Adobe Flash Player environments and web applications requiring high-quality video compression. Content creators, media companies, and educational platforms frequently utilize this format for delivering video content.

Frequently Asked Questions

SWF is a proprietary Adobe Flash animation format using vector graphics and interactive scripting, while F4V is a modern video container format based on MP4 technology, supporting H.264 video and AAC audio encoding. The primary technical difference lies in their underlying data structures: SWF supports interactive animations and ActionScript, whereas F4V is a standard video format designed for streaming and playback across multiple platforms.

Users convert from SWF to F4V primarily to overcome the declining support for Adobe Flash, ensure compatibility with modern web browsers and mobile devices, and preserve multimedia content that would otherwise become inaccessible. F4V offers superior video compression, broader device support, and alignment with HTML5 video standards.

Common conversion scenarios include migrating legacy web animations, preserving educational multimedia presentations, converting vintage online game interfaces, archiving historical web content, and updating interactive marketing materials to modern video formats.

The conversion from SWF to F4V typically results in moderate quality preservation. Vector graphics may experience some rendering differences, and interactive elements are likely to be converted to static video. Users can expect comparable visual fidelity, though complex animations might lose some original interactivity.

F4V conversions generally result in file size reductions of 20-40% compared to original SWF files. The more efficient H.264 compression in F4V allows for smaller file sizes while maintaining similar or improved visual quality.

Conversion limitations include potential loss of interactive scripting, ActionScript functionality, and complex vector animations. Not all SWF interactive elements can be perfectly translated to a video format, which may result in simplified output.

Avoid converting SWF files that require complex user interactions, contain critical ActionScript functionality, or are part of active web applications. Conversion is not recommended when preserving exact original interactivity is crucial.

Alternative approaches include using HTML5 canvas for recreating interactive content, preserving original SWF files with legacy browser support, or rebuilding animations using modern web technologies like JavaScript and CSS animations.